MHK is a brand (often seen on budget-friendly security DVRs sold through online marketplaces like Amazon, eBay, or AliExpress). These DVRs are typically H.264/H.265 standalone recorders for analog or HD-TVI cameras. They run a customized Linux-based embedded OS with a default GUI for local monitor + mouse control, plus remote viewing via P2P/DDNS.

For systems that do not support remote software unlocking, a "Super Password" is often required. MHK DVRs typically generate a unique temporary password based on the current date and time displayed on the monitor.
